Excel vs Power BI: Which One Should Finance Professionals Learn First?
Introduction
Section of Finance & Data-Driven Decisions As finance professionals today work in an environment that relies heavily on data to assist them in their decision-making, the need for accurate data to support every financial analysis has never been greater. From making budget decisions to determining potential investment opportunities or assessing risk and performance, every financial decision is based on sound information. In this report, we are going to compare two highly effective financial analysis tools available to finance professionals today – Microsoft Excel and Microsoft Power BI. While Excel has served as the primary analytical tool for finance professionals for decades, Power BI is emerging as a modern business intelligence platform that provides businesses with an opportunity to automate and visualise their data.
Given the unique characteristics of these two software applications and how they both assist professionals in performing their day-to-day tasks, students and professionals alike often find themselves asking themselves.
Which tool is best for me to learn first, Excel or Power BI?
Introduction to the Comparative Analysis and
Understanding Excel
• To answer the question accurately and meaningfully, it is
essential to first develop a thorough understanding of both
tools individually before attempting any form of comparison. A
direct comparison without this foundation would be incomplete
and potentially misleading, as it would ignore the purpose,
structure, and intended use of each tool in academic and
professional contexts.
• This report therefore adopts a structured and methodical
approach by explaining each tool in detail using long,
descriptive bullet points. Each explanation focuses on the core
purpose of the tool, how it is commonly used, and the practical
value it offers to students and professionals who rely on these
tools for assignments, academic submissions, data analysis, and
structured problem-solving.
• Microsoft Excel, in particular, is a spreadsheet-based
application designed to organise, analyse, and interpret data in
a highly structured format. It operates through workbooks that
contain multiple worksheets, allowing users to logically
separate raw data, calculations, assumptions, and final outputs.
This structure makes Excel especially effective for numerical
analysis, financial modelling, budgeting, forecasting,
statistical evaluation, and visual representation of data
through charts and dashboards.
• For students, Excel supports academic work by enabling
accurate calculations, clean tabular presentation, graphical
analysis, and reproducible results, which are critical for
assignments and coursework. For professionals, Excel functions
as a powerful analytical and decision-support tool, allowing
them to build models, automate calculations, test scenarios, and
present insights in a clear and structured manner, making it an
indispensable skill in both educational and professional
environments.
I. What is Excel, Exactly?
Understanding Excel as a Financial
Tool
• Microsoft Excel is a highly flexible software
application that enables finance professionals to
create, edit, and analyse numerical data in a structured
yet fully customisable environment. Unlike many modern
accounting or ERP systems that operate within predefined
rules and layouts, Excel gives users complete control
over model design, calculation logic, data manipulation
methods, worksheet connections, and the overall
structure and presentation of financial
information.
• This level of flexibility is the primary reason Excel
continues to be the most widely used tool among finance
professionals across industries. Whether the task
involves complex financial modelling, simple arithmetic
calculations, sensitivity analysis, or detailed
analytical workflows, Excel is capable of handling all
of them without imposing structural or design
limitations on the user.
• Excel begins as a blank worksheet, which can be
transformed into virtually any financial tool
required—such as a budgeting model, forecasting
framework, valuation model, performance dashboard, or
decision-support system. This adaptability allows
finance professionals to design solutions that precisely
match the analytical problem they are trying to solve
rather than forcing their analysis into rigid software
templates.
• Finance professionals place significant value on Excel
because every organisation operates differently, with
unique business models, cost structures, revenue
streams, and reporting requirements. Excel’s
customisation capability allows analysts to build models
that reflect the specific realities of their
organisation, making it an indispensable tool for
accurate analysis, meaningful reporting, and informed
decision-making.
II. Why is Excel Still the Foundation for a Finance Career?
Excel as the Universal Language of
Finance
• Excel is the most widely used software across all
industries and is deeply embedded in every function and
role within the finance profession. From entry-level
analysts to senior leadership, Excel is consistently
relied upon for data analysis, reporting, modelling, and
decision support, making it an essential tool regardless
of job title or sector.
• Because of its widespread adoption, Excel functions as
the universal language of finance. Financial models,
reports, assumptions, and analyses are commonly shared,
reviewed, and understood through Excel files, allowing
professionals from different organisations, industries,
and geographies to collaborate using a common analytical
framework.
• Proficiency in Excel is therefore a foundational
requirement for both students and professionals. Before
learning advanced finance tools, analytics platforms, or
specialised software, individuals must first develop
strong Excel skills, as most advanced systems build upon
the same logical, numerical, and analytical principles
introduced through Excel.
• Mastering Excel enables learners to understand
financial concepts more effectively and equips
professionals with the confidence to adapt quickly to
new technologies. As a result, Excel remains the
starting point and continuous reference tool for
financial education, professional growth, and long-term
career success in finance.
Advanced Excel Abilities (Depth of Explanation)
Advanced Analytical Capabilities of
Excel
• Excel’s advanced formulas and formula-based functions—such as
VLOOKUP, XLOOKUP, INDEX-MATCH, SUMIF, COUNTIF, IFERROR, NPV,
IRR, and PMT—enable users to perform a wide range of
calculations, from basic arithmetic to complex financial and
statistical analysis. These functions allow finance
professionals to build logical structures within models,
manipulate raw data dynamically, and convert assumptions into
meaningful financial outputs such as profitability, cash flow
projections, valuation metrics, and repayment schedules.
• By combining these formulas within structured models, Excel
allows users to simulate real-world business scenarios and
understand how different inputs interact with each other. This
logical framework makes it possible to test assumptions,
automate calculations, and ensure consistency across large
datasets, which is essential for accurate financial modelling,
forecasting, and decision-making.
• Excel’s pivot table functionality is one of its most powerful
features for summarising and reorganising large volumes of data
into clear, meaningful reports. Pivot tables allow finance teams
to quickly analyse revenue and cost trends, evaluate product or
regional performance, and assess profitability across multiple
dimensions. Through easy grouping, filtering, sorting, and
drill-down capabilities, users can extract insights from complex
datasets with minimal effort.
• Additionally, Excel’s What-If Analysis tools—such as Goal
Seek, Scenario Manager, and Data Tables—provide robust methods
for forecasting outcomes under uncertainty. These tools help
finance professionals evaluate how changes in key variables,
such as interest rates, sales growth, or cost assumptions,
impact profit, cash flow, or net present value. As a result,
Excel supports objective, data-driven decision-making by
allowing users to explore multiple outcomes before committing to
strategic or financial decisions.
I. Understanding Power BI in Detail
What Power BI Really Is
• Power BI is a business intelligence and data
visualisation platform designed to transform raw,
unstructured data into interactive dashboards, visual
reports, and clear analytical insights that are easily
understood by managers and decision-makers. Its primary
objective is not data entry or calculation, but insight
generation and performance monitoring through visual
storytelling.
• Unlike Excel, which is fundamentally a
spreadsheet-based tool built around cells, formulas, and
manual model design, Power BI is centred on connecting
directly to multiple data sources. These sources can
include databases, cloud systems, ERP platforms,
accounting software, and Excel files. Power BI
automatically refreshes, cleans, and structures large
datasets so they are ready for analysis without
repetitive manual effort.
• Power BI specialises in handling large volumes of data
and converting them into visually intuitive formats such
as charts, graphs, KPIs, scorecards, and dashboards.
This visual-first approach allows users to quickly
identify trends, patterns, variances, and performance
issues with a high level of confidence, even when
working with complex or multi-dimensional data.
• By presenting insights in a concise and interactive
manner, Power BI enables organisations to understand
business performance trends more clearly and make
faster, better-informed decisions. It is particularly
valuable for management reporting, performance tracking,
and strategic analysis, where clarity, speed, and
real-time visibility are more important than detailed
spreadsheet-level calculations.
II. Why Power BI Is Important in Finance
Automated Reporting and Real-Time Insights with
Power BI
• Power BI enables full automation of reporting
processes, eliminating the repetitive manual effort
traditionally required to prepare reports. Once
dashboards are created, reports are generated
automatically, allowing finance teams to rely on live
Power BI dashboards rather than repeatedly building the
same reports each reporting cycle.
• By connecting directly to data sources such as
databases, Excel files, ERP systems, and cloud
platforms, Power BI ensures that dashboards refresh
automatically whenever the underlying data is updated.
This capability is especially critical for finance teams
that depend on timely access to monthly management
information, sales performance dashboards, product cost
analysis, and key performance indicators to support
accurate and timely decision-making.
• For organisations that handle very large volumes of
data—such as financial institutions, retail chains,
telecommunications providers, and e-commerce
businesses—Power BI is particularly effective. It can
process and analyse millions of rows of data while
maintaining performance and clarity, making it suitable
for enterprise-level reporting and analysis.
• Power BI also offers powerful interactive features
that allow users to explore data dynamically. Tools such
as slicers, filters, drill-downs, and interactive
visualisations enable users to investigate trends,
compare segments, and uncover deeper insights by simply
clicking through dashboards, enhancing analytical depth
without requiring technical expertise.
Power BI's Key Features (Explained Further)
Advanced Data Processing and Analytics in Power BI• Power BI leverages Power Query to automatically clean, transform, and consolidate complex and messy datasets. Finance professionals often spend significant time preparing raw data before analysis, but Power Query allows them to define a repeatable set of data-cleaning steps—such as removing errors, standardising formats, merging files, and reshaping tables—that can be applied consistently every time new data is received. This automation ensures accuracy, saves time, and removes manual inconsistencies from the data preparation process.
• Power BI uses DAX (Data Analysis Expressions), a powerful analytical formula language designed specifically for advanced calculations and business intelligence reporting. While DAX follows some logical principles similar to Excel formulas, it is far more robust and dynamic. It enables finance teams to create complex measures such as year-to-date and month-to-date calculations, running totals, moving averages, growth rates, percentage variances, and dynamic ratios that automatically respond to filters and slicers within dashboards.
• Power BI dashboards are highly visual and interactive, allowing users to explore data intuitively rather than relying on static reports. These dashboards can be securely published and shared through the cloud-based Power BI Service, making them easily accessible across an organisation. Executives, managers, and analysts can view real-time reports on laptops, tablets, or mobile devices without managing multiple report versions or files.
• As a result, Power BI enhances collaboration, improves decision speed, and ensures that all stakeholders are working from a single, trusted source of data. This combination of automated data preparation, advanced analytics, and cloud-based accessibility makes Power BI a powerful tool for modern finance teams focused on efficiency, accuracy, and insight-driven decision-making.
I. Comparison Between Excel and Power BI
Differences in Intended Use and Data Handling• Excel is primarily designed for detailed financial modelling, calculations, forecasting, budgeting, and scenario-based analysis where users require high precision and full control. In Excel, assumptions are created manually, formulas are built individually, and logic is customised cell by cell. This makes Excel ideal for analysts who want to design their own models from scratch, test assumptions flexibly, and directly manipulate numbers to understand financial outcomes in depth.
• Power BI, on the other hand, was developed with a different objective: to automate reporting and visualise large volumes of data in an interactive and management-friendly format. Rather than focusing on manual model creation, Power BI specialises in transforming existing data into dashboards, charts, KPIs, and summary reports that senior management can easily interpret. It enhances reporting efficiency by reducing repetitive manual work and ensuring consistency across reports.
• Excel performs well when working with small to moderately large datasets, but performance typically degrades as data volumes increase beyond a few hundred thousand rows. Large datasets can cause Excel files to become slow, unstable, or difficult to manage, which limits its effectiveness for organisations that rely on real-time or high-volume data environments.
• Power BI is built to handle very large datasets efficiently using in-memory data compression and a robust analytical engine. Its architecture allows organisations to store, process, and analyse millions of rows of data quickly and reliably. As a result, Power BI is better suited for businesses that require scalable analytics, real-time insights, and enterprise-level reporting, while Excel remains essential for detailed modelling and hands-on financial analysis.
Capabilities of Automated Systems
Automation and Refresh Capabilities: Excel vs Power
BI
• Excel typically requires manual updates whenever underlying
data changes, unless advanced features such as macros or Power
Query are implemented. Even with these tools, users usually need
to trigger data refreshes themselves. In finance teams, this
often results in repetitive manual activities such as preparing
monthly reports, updating figures, or copying raw data into
predefined Excel templates, which consumes time and increases
the risk of human error.
• In contrast, Power BI is built around automated data refresh
and live reporting. Once dashboards are connected to data
sources, they refresh automatically whenever the underlying data
changes. This eliminates the need for manual monthly updates and
saves finance teams many hours of repetitive work, while
ensuring that insights remain current, consistent, and reliable
at all times.
• After a Power BI dashboard is created, it becomes a
continuously updating reporting system rather than a static
file. Finance professionals and decision-makers can rely on
Power BI to always reflect the latest numbers, improving
confidence in reporting and enabling faster, more informed
decisions without repeated manual intervention.
What Should You Learn First: Excel or Power
BI?
• The recommended learning path is to learn Excel
first and then progress to Power
BI. Excel builds the foundational principles of
finance, logic, and data structure, including how data is
organised, how relationships between data points work, and how
calculations and assumptions are constructed—skills that are
essential before using any advanced reporting or analytics
tool.
• Excel remains the core daily working tool for finance
professionals. Most finance roles require strong Excel
proficiency for tasks such as calculations, modelling, analysis,
and ad-hoc problem-solving. Power BI is typically used as a
higher-level reporting and visualisation tool that complements
Excel rather than replaces it.
• In finance job applications and interviews, candidates are
almost always expected to demonstrate hands-on Excel skills.
Employers assess whether candidates can perform day-to-day tasks
such as analysing data, building models, and solving problems
using Excel, making it a non-negotiable skill for entering the
finance profession.
• Although Power BI uses DAX formulas that resemble Excel
functions, learning DAX is significantly more difficult without
prior Excel knowledge. Understanding how formulas interact, why
certain calculations are structured in specific ways, and how
data logic flows is first developed through Excel. This
foundation makes transitioning to Power BI and mastering DAX far
more intuitive and effective.
Conclusion
Automation and Refresh Capabilities: Excel vs Power
BI
• Excel generally requires manual intervention to keep data up
to date. Unless advanced tools such as macros or Power Query are
implemented, users must manually update figures whenever source
data changes. Even when these tools are used, refresh actions
are usually triggered by the user. In practical finance team
environments, this often results in repetitive tasks such as
rebuilding monthly reports, copying updated data into templates,
and validating numbers each reporting cycle. These repetitive
processes consume valuable time and increase the likelihood of
human error, version mismatches, and inconsistencies across
reports.
• Power BI, by contrast, is designed around automated data
refresh and live reporting. Once dashboards are connected to
underlying data sources—such as databases, ERP systems, Excel
files, or cloud platforms—they refresh automatically based on
scheduled intervals or real-time updates. This removes the need
for manual monthly or periodic updates and allows finance teams
to focus on analysis rather than report preparation, while
ensuring that all users are working with the most current and
accurate data available.
• After a Power BI dashboard is created and deployed, it
functions as a continuously updating reporting system rather
than a static document. Finance professionals, managers, and
executives can rely on these dashboards to always reflect the
latest performance metrics, which improves trust in reporting,
reduces reconciliation efforts, and enables faster, more
confident decision-making without repeated manual
intervention.
What Should You Learn First: Excel or Power
BI?
• The recommended learning sequence is to master Excel
first and then move on to Power
BI. Excel develops the foundational principles of
finance, data logic, and analytical thinking. Through Excel,
users learn how data is structured, how relationships between
datasets are formed, how assumptions are built, and how
calculations drive financial outcomes—knowledge that is
essential before adopting more advanced analytics and reporting
platforms.
• Excel remains the primary day-to-day working tool for finance
professionals across industries. Most finance roles depend
heavily on Excel for calculations, financial modelling,
budgeting, forecasting, variance analysis, and ad-hoc
problem-solving. Power BI typically complements Excel by serving
as a higher-level reporting and visualisation layer, rather than
acting as a complete replacement for Excel-based
analysis.
• In finance job applications and interviews, strong Excel
proficiency is almost always a core requirement. Employers
expect candidates to demonstrate practical Excel skills,
including data analysis, formula usage, modelling logic, and
problem-solving ability. Without solid Excel knowledge, it is
difficult to meet the expectations of most finance roles,
regardless of familiarity with newer tools.
• Although Power BI uses DAX formulas that resemble Excel
functions in structure and logic, learning DAX without Excel
experience is significantly more challenging. A solid
understanding of how formulas interact, how calculations are
layered, and how data logic flows is typically developed through
Excel first. This foundation makes the transition to Power BI
smoother and allows users to learn DAX more effectively and
apply it with confidence.
